Supreme Court Upholds Removal of Employee Convicted of Theft While Under Suspension — Limitation Bar Applied for Delayed Challenge. The Court held that a removal order under Rule 19(i) of CCS (CCA) Rules is not a continuing wrong and delay of 13 years cannot be condoned without sufficient cause.

Bombay High Court Grants Bail to Accused in NDPS Case Due to Non-Commercial Quantity and Long Incarceration. The court held that the quantity of Codeine (200 grams) was less than commercial quantity (1000 grams), thus Section 37 NDPS Act not attracted, and granted bail considering the period of custody.
